Damaged tile replacement services involve removing broken, cracked, or otherwise compromised tiles and installing new ones in their place. This process typically includes carefully extracting the damaged tiles without harming surrounding surfaces, preparing the underlying surface for new tile adhesion, and securely installing the replacement tiles to match the existing pattern and finish. Skilled service providers ensure that the new tiles blend seamlessly with the existing flooring or wall surface, restoring the aesthetic appeal and functionality of the space.

These services address common problems such as cracked or chipped tiles, loose tiles, and tiles that have become stained or discolored over time. Damaged tiles not only detract from the visual appeal of a property but can also pose safety hazards, such as creating tripping risks or exposing underlying surfaces to moisture damage. Replacing damaged tiles helps maintain the integrity of the surface, prevents further deterioration, and preserves the overall value of the property.

The overview below groups typical Damaged Tile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Spartanburg County, SC.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Per Tile Replacement - Costs typically range from $10 to $30 per tile, depending on size and material. For example, replacing a single standard ceramic tile may cost around $15.

Labor Charges - Labor fees for damaged tile removal and replacement can vary from $50 to $150 per hour. The total cost depends on the number of tiles and complexity of access.

Material Expenses - The price of replacement tiles varies widely, from $2 to $50 per tile, based on type and quality. Specialty or custom tiles tend to be at the higher end of the range.

Additional Costs - Surface preparation or subfloor repair may add $100 to $300 to the overall cost. These expenses depend on the extent of damage and the specific project requ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
